From soothing to teaching: what Toleroxyl really is

Toleroxyl is a plant-derived human protein ingredient created to re-educate hyperreactive urban skin, restoring immune tolerance so that sensitive, pollution-exposed skin learns to respond calmly instead of inflaming at every minor trigger. That definition matters, because it signals a philosophical shift in skin care: the goal is no longer to numb redness for a few hours, but to change how the skin’s immune system interprets everyday stress. Modern consumers describe skin that “overreacts to everything” or “never stays calm for long,” a pattern that likely reflects a misfiring immune filter rather than weak skin. How Toleroxyl trains Langerhans cells to choose calm over chaos

The science behind this sensitive skin protein is not cosmetic fluff; it targets the immune decision-makers of the epidermis: Langerhans cells. Toleroxyl helps hyperreactive urban skin restore tolerance, comfort, and visible resilience by acting on these cells, which decide whether the skin responds with inflammation or tolerance. It works through a mechanism based on GM-CSF, a human protein involved in the differentiation, survival, and functional programming of Langerhans cells. By binding to GM-CSF receptors, the active helps keep them in a calm, tolerance-supporting state. Calmed Langerhans cells then promote the release of TGF-β, reducing inflammatory signals like TNF-α, IL-8, and IL-6 and supporting a healthier, non-inflamed environment. In vitro, Toleroxyl activates tolerogenic pathways by restoring RELB and SOX4 while normalizing immunogenic markers such as CCR7, CD80, and CD86, and it reinforces barrier markers, including Filaggrin, Loricrin, and Claudin-4.

Clinical context: beyond neurocosmetics and into immune re-education skincare

Neurocosmetics focus on the communication between skin and the nervous system, using neurosensory-calming ingredients and adaptogens to improve comfort and visible stress signs. They see skin as a network of nerve endings, neurotransmitters, neuropeptides, and receptors that constantly communicate with the brain and immune system. Toleroxyl belongs to a neighbouring but distinct movement: immune re-education skincare. Instead of mainly calming nerve-driven sensations, it works on immune programming, proposing “train the skin, do not silence it.” Clinical studies on volunteers with hyperreactive skin showed visible benefits like reduced redness and erythema, plus relief from stinging, itching, burning, and tightness, alongside in vivo reductions of IL-8, TNF-α, and IL-6.
